Spontaneous oscillations in a single mode CO/sub 2/ laser in a Fabry-Perot cavity
- 1. Dept. of Physics, Bryn Mawr College, Bryn Mawr, PA 19010
Description
The authors show the existence of self-pulsing at two characteristic frequencies in a single mode CO/sub 2/ laser for low pump rates. The dynamical behavior of the system as a function of the pump rate, cavity losses and detuning between atomic and cavity frequencies has been investigated. These results can be explained by a recently developed theoretical model which incorporates intensity dependent parameters
